• High-capacity, lightweight and compact lithium-ion battery with estimated battery life display • Enhanced recording options include automatic switching of recording media, separate recordings to media and identical recordings to multiple media • Silent mode for single images • Image copying and backup to external media enabled • ISO speed safety shift • ISO speed and metering pattern always displayed in viewfinder and on top LCD data panel • New control layout with SET button, AF On button and Multi-Controller • Displayable camera settings and better image information during playback • Histogram display, jump display, error code display, and shooting settings display • Chassis, mirror box, and exterior covers made of magnesium alloy • Maintains water resistance with new 580EX II Speedlite • Personal Functions consolidated with Custom Functions, resulting in 57 Custom Functions in 4 groups • Custom Function settings can be registered and called up • Camera settings can be saved and read • Camera's basic settings can be registered and applied • New "My Menu" function can be registered and displayed at startup • Camera direct printing (PictBridge) improved and DPOF print ordering provided • Direct printing of RAW and sRAW images • Direct image transfer • Wireless/wired LAN for image transfers via new WFT-E2A dedicated Wireless File Transmitter • External USB recording media and GPS unit usable via the WFT-E2A • Verification data can be generated, encrypted and appended to the image with new Original Data Security Kit OSK-E3 • Compatible with original image verification system • Speedlite Custom Functions settable with the camera when the 580EX II Speedlite is attached • New software package includes Digital Photo Professional 3.0 and EOS Utility 2.0 • New EF 16-35mm f/2.8L II USM lens features improved peripheral image quality 2 Actual price set by dealers and may vary.
